Steps To Install Playstore In Gameloop
Follow the steps below to install playstore in gameloop.
Step 1: Open Gameloop
Open your gameloop emulator and open any game to open aow engine.
In my case, I am opening freefire.


Step 2: Exit
Now after launching the aow engine, when the game starts loading exit the game and you will return to the emulator.

Step 3: Open Browser
Now press F9 you will see the browser. If F9 not working then you can press “CTRL+ F9”. Then open the browser.

Step 4: Open Playstore
Now on google search “play.google.com” then you get playstore option. Now click on it and your playstore is opened on your gameloop emulator.


Done. you opened playstore on gameloop emulator easily.

Alternative Method To Get Playstore On Gameloop
Step 1: Open Gameloop
Open your gameloop emulator and open any game to open aow engine.
In my case, I am opening freefire.


Step 2: Exit
Now after launching the aow engine, when the game starts loading exit the game and you will return to the emulator.

Step 3: Open Settings
Now press F9 you will see the settings. If F9 not working then you can press “CTRL+ F9”. Then open the settings.

Step 4: Go To Apps
Now scroll down and go to the app. Then find “google play services” and click on it. After that scroll down and click on “App details”.



Done. you opened play store on gameloop emulator easily.

Trouble
Sometimes you may get into trouble and maybe get both of the methods not working. So in this case you can follow the instructions below.
You just need to make sure if you have installed “Google Installer” in gameloop or not? If not then install “Google Installer”.
